protected void installDefaults(JXStatusBar sb) { //only set the border if it is an instanceof UIResource //In other words, only replace the border if it has not been //set by the developer. UIResource is the flag we use to indicate whether //the value was set by the UIDelegate, or by the developer. Border b = statusBar.getBorder(); if (b == null || b instanceof UIResource) { statusBar.setBorder(createBorder()); } LookAndFeel.installProperty(sb, "opaque", Boolean.TRUE); }
